European Union Terre des Hommes co-launches European initiative against traveling sex offenders

Project : TDHIF in Europe 13 Jul 2009

356_terre_des_hommes_co-launches_european_initiative_against_traveling_sex_offenders_0_small Extract: After co-launching an initiative at the European Parliament last year, Terre des Hommes is working together with the European Economic and Social Committee to give international fight against traveling sex offender an impulse. The initiative, written by Ms. Sharma as rapporteur for the Section for Employment, Social Affairs and Citizenship concentrates on strategies to stop traveling sex offenders. It includes measures to work with tourist organizations to help them identify and stop child exploitation as well as strengthening international police cooperation. It propagates greater use of traveling restrictions for convicted offenders.

Terre des Hommes is pleased to see a growing political consensus developing that action against traveling sex offenders is necessary. Lucien StÜpler, spokesperson, explained what makes children vulnerable and the role that European member States – often through police – and the tourist industry can play in enhancing child protection. Furthermore, he stressed that solutions are to be found close to the children, within their communities and through their agencies. “We must all engage the European member States, who must stop their citizens and help the police abroad and here to convict those who victimize children for their own base pleasure.”
